Black Dyke sign new cornet duo

Black Dyke welcomes Jon Hammond and Adam Finch to their cornet section.

  Black Dyke has welcomed two new additions to its cornet section

Black Dyke has added two new signings to the ranks following their performance at the Royal Albert Hall on the weekend.

New signings

Jon Hammond comes in on assistant principal cornet with Adam Finch joining on third cornet.

"It's a real privilege to join Black Dyke,"Jon told 4BR. "It's been a lifelong goal of mine to be a part of this amazing band and to do this and be sat between my brother, Tim and Richard Marshall makes it even more special.

I'm really looking forward to working with Prof Childs, but I would like to thank David Roberts and Rothwell Band for their support and friendship over the last 18 years."

Meanwhile, University of Salford post-graduate student Adam has been a regular dep in the cornet section over the past year, and was an obvious choice when a vacancy became available.

Principal cornet Richard Marshall told 4BR: "For the last few years I've taught Adam at the university and I've been so impressed with his commitment and attitude. I wish both Jon and Adam many happy years with the band."

The duo will make their debuts in concert at Sheffield Citadel on Thursday 19th October.
